Configuring a VPN Security Association using IKE and a Third Party Certificate

To create a VPN SA using IKE and third party certificates, follow these steps:
1. Click VPN, then Configure. In the Add/Modify IPSec Associations section, Select IKE using 3rd

Party Certificates from the IPSec Keying Mode menu.

2. Enter a Name for the Security Association in the Name field.
3. Select a certificate from the Select Certificate list.
4. Enter the Gateway address in the IPSec Gateway Address field.
5. In the Security Policy section, select the type of DH group from the Phase 1 DH Group menu.
6. The SA Lifetime (secs) automatically defaults to 28800 seconds (8 hours).
7. Select the type of Phase 1 Encryption/Authentication from the menu.
8. Select the type of Phase 2 Encryption/Authentication from the menu.
9. In the Peer Certificate’s ID section, you must select the ID Type from the ID Type menu. You can

select Distinguished Name, E-mail ID, or Domain Name from the menu. Then cut and paste the
information from the Local Certificate into the text field.

10. In the Destination Networks section, select the type of destination for the VPN tunnel:

- Use this SA as default route for all Internet traffic can be used for only one SA, and routes all
VPN traffic destined for the WAN through the SA.
- Destination network obtains IP addresses using DHCP through this SA to allow computers at
the VPN destination to obtain IP addresses using DHCP over VPN.
- Specify destination network below If the VPN destination is a specific IP address.

11. Click Add New Network... Enter the network IP address and subnet mask in the fields, and click

OK.

SonicWALL Enhanced VPN Logging

If Network Debug is selected in the Log Settings tab panel, detailed logs are kept of the VPN
negotiations with the SonicWALL appliance. Enhanced VPN Logging is useful for evaluating VPN
connections when problems can occur with the connections.
To use the enhanced VPN Logging feature, perform the following steps:
1. Click Log on the left side of the management interface.

2. Click on the Logging Settings tab, and locate the Network Debug check box.
